Step-by-Step Guide to Building Your PA Speaker

1. Gather Your Materials

Before starting, ensure you have all the necessary materials and tools. This includes the DWG drawings, plywood or MDF for the cabinet, drivers (woofers, tweeters), crossovers, screws, glue, and a CNC machine.

2. Review the Drawings

Carefully review the DWG drawings for your chosen model. Take note of the dimensions, materials, and any specific instructions.

3. Cut the Panels

Using the CNC machine, cut the panels according to the specifications in the drawings. Precision is crucial to ensure all pieces fit together perfectly.

4. Assemble the Cabinet

Begin assembling the cabinet by gluing and screwing the panels together. Ensure the structure is sturdy and free from gaps that could affect sound quality.

5. Install the Drivers

Mount the drivers in their designated positions. Follow the wiring diagram provided in the drawings to connect the drivers to the crossover.

6. Finish the Cabinet

Sand the exterior of the cabinet to smooth out any rough edges. You can paint or veneer the cabinet for a professional finish.

7. Test Your Speaker

Once assembled, test your PA speaker to ensure it meets your sound quality expectations. Make any necessary adjustments to optimize performance.
